1. Leave Your Booth Open and Inviting

First impressions are everything. Just as a department store with a wide, open entrance invites customers in, your trade show booth should be welcoming. Resist the temptation to fill the space with too much. Instead, choose an open, clean design that invites visitors to step inside and explore it.

Simple design choices, including fewer pieces of furniture and deliberate placement of your trade show display stands, can make your stand appear larger than it actually is. An open space also facilitates easier movement by your staff and easier interaction with visitors.

2. Use Vertical and Wall Space

When space is tight, think vertically. Use your booth’s wall height to display important visuals, messaging, or products. This method frees up table space and draws eyes upward, helping your booth stand out across the room.

Adding lighting above or beneath your wall-mounted displays can further enhance their visibility. Whether you’re showcasing products or a message, eye-level visuals are more likely to catch attention from passersby.

3. Create Hidden Storage Solutions

Storage is often overlooked when planning small booths, but it’s essential, especially if you’re exhibiting for multiple days or bringing many materials. Look for innovative ways to hide extra items while keeping them easily accessible.

For example, use display cubes that double as storage, or tuck items under tables draped with floor-length covers. Ensure anything stored is out of view but easy to reach for your team when needed.

4. Utilize Your Lighting

Lighting can dramatically impact how people perceive your booth. Good lighting can make a small space feel larger, highlight key features, and create a warm, professional vibe.

Bring your own lights to enhance your setup. Most venue lighting is dull and uniform. Use focused downlighting to spotlight products or directional lighting to emphasize your signs and banners. These small touches can help your booth look more polished and attract more visitors.

 5. Choose the Right Trade Show Display

Your display setup plays a key role in maximizing your booth. For smaller spaces, banner stands for trade shows or tabletop displays with custom covers are often ideal. They’re compact, professional, and easy to set up.

Consider tension fabric displays or digital trade show displays for medium or large booths to make a bigger impact. Digital elements like screens or touch displays can create interactive experiences without taking up much floor space.
